Siteone Landscape Supply
Open
1385 E 36th St
Cleveland, OH 44114
SiteOne Landscape Supply in Cleveland, OH is a supplier of landscaping materials and supplies for professionals in the industry.
They offer a wide range of products such as irrigation systems, hardscapes, and plants to support landscaping projects of all sizes.
Generated from their business information
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.


